The debtor might be able to shell out fewer than what is owed, or change the interest price or quantity of months to pay. In Trade, the debtor in a Chapter 13 case should repay unsecured creditors a visit this web-site percentage of their promises with the debtor’s potential earnings over A 3-year to 5-yr interval. Ordinarily, the debtor will make every month payments towards the Chapter thirteen trustee, who then pays the creditors according to the approach submitted from the debtor, accepted by the creditors, and authorized with the bankruptcy judge.  The debtor pays the trustee a established amount based on his month-to-month earnings from all sources, much less preset living expenses.

As an example, Enable’s examine two different scenarios involving a lien on a motor vehicle. When you have an outstanding stability on your vehicle bank loan and also the car was pledged as security when you purchased the vehicle, bankruptcy doesn’t undo that pledge. Bankruptcy may reduce you of personal duty for your personal debt, but the safety fascination remains.
